This is an activity that I created for my American History class that can be done in the classroom or in the computer lab (need access to YouTube). **UPDATED on 6/28/20: This activity is available in the following formats: Microsoft Word, Google Docs, and PDF. Fun distance learning enrichment activity that students will engage with.

Students listen to 6 songs (titles listed below) and are to analyze the songs in a graphic organizer and then complete a reflection. They should be able to compare and contrast the lyrics/tones from some of the popular songs of the 1970s. Then I follow up the activity with a discussion about the music/tones/lyrics.

Lyric sheets are provided for each of the 7 (Included an extra song - students still only have room on the chart for 6 songs) songs:

"Dancing Queen" - ABBA

"Stairway to Heaven" - Led Zeppelin

"Superstition" - Stevie Wonder

"Imagine" - John Lennon

"Bohemian Rhapsody" - Queen

"Stayin Alive" - Bee Gees

"I Will Survive" - Gloria Gaynor
